+880 is the country calling code assigned to Bangladesh by the International Telecommunication Union. All of the country’s telephone numbers are also designated under the Bangladesh Telecommunications Act of 2001 created by the Telecommunication Regulatory Commission of the Bangladesh Government. Bangladesh’s telephone numbers are made up of 12 to 13 numbers split into groups of 4. So if you’re going to make a call to Bangladesh using a mobile phone, you should dial country code+area code+8-digit number. Some of the common area codes in Bangladesh include Dhaka (2), Chittagong (31) and Bogra (51).
So if you’re making a call to Dhaka, dial +880 2 1234 5678.Network coverage is moderately available across Bangladesh. LTE connection is moderately available across the country, but quality highly depends on the mobile operator.
